I have observed duplicate packages (org.apache.falcon.entity.v0, org.apache.falcon.plugin) in some packages due to which I have included their dependencies in a specific poms. they have eaten me time which in the last found that I was putting one dependency to mean another project's dependency. 

Is this common in these types of projects or can we avoid such duplication ?
